About the GWCVB

The Greater Wilmington Convention & Visitors Bureau is a non-profit organization founded in 1978, chartered by the Governor of Delaware, the New Castle County Executive and the Mayor of Wilmington.

Its mission is to serve as the community's customer-focused destination marketing organization, generating economic growth through leisure travel and MEETINGS development by aggressively marketing ATTRACTIONS, facilities, amenities and SERVICES FOR VISITORS.

As a result, the GWCVB seeks to produce higher volumes of visitors, visitor spending, and tax revenues, to generate and sustain jobs and to enhance the quality of life for our residents.

The GWCVB is governed by a board of 27 members - seven appointed by the Governor of Delaware, seven by the New Castle County Executive and seven by the Mayor of the City of Wilmington. These 21 elect six. The Director of Delaware Tourism and the Executive Director are ex official members of the Board.
